Section four. Procedure

four.1) Description

four.1.1) Type of procedure

Negotiated without a prior call for competition

  • Extreme urgency brought about by events unforeseeable for the contracting authority

Explanation:

The award of this contract to a single supplier relies on Public Contract Regulations 2015 32(2)(b)(ii) where supplies or services can only be supplied by a particular supplier when competition is absent for technical reasons, but only where no reasonable alternative or substitute exists and the absence of competition is not the result of an artificial narrowing down of the parameters of the procurement.

This Direct Award Contract will cover a three year period, during which they will be testing the market for a new contract to commence in 2027.
